2   09-07-2025

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ned

A.P.P for the State.

2. The petitioner is apprehending arrest in connection

with Rajepur P.S. Case No. 87 of 2016 lodged on 26.07.2016,

for the offence punishable under Sections 147, 148, 149, 144,

153A, 153B, 295(A), 297, 353, 505, 452, 380, 307, 323, 324,

431, 341, 342, 427, 188, 337 & 120B of the Indian Penal Code

read with section 27 of the Arms Act and sections 3 & 4 of the

Prevention of Damages to Public Property Act, 1984 pending in

the Court of Sub-Divisional Judicial Magistrate, Sadar, East

Champaran, Motihari.

3. As per the prosecution, FIR has been lodged against
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.42381 of 2025(2) dt.09-07-2025
2/3

79 named accused persons and more than 1000 unknown

persons. It has been alleged in the FIR that a large number of

people holding weapons in their hands had gathered and they

were damaging the public property and firing at mosque in the

village and they were also committing loot at nearby shops.

Thereafter, when the police party and local administration tried

to pacify the matter, the gathered people scuffled with them and

damaged the government vehicles.

4.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the

petitioner is innocent and has committed no offence. Counsel

submits that there is general and omnibus allegation against all

the accused persons. Counsel submits that the criminal

antecedent of the petitioner is not clean as there are 13 cases

pending against him and only due to this reason at the instance

of police, name of the petitioner has been inserted in this case.

Counsel submits that petitioner is on bail in all the 13 cases

pending against him.

5. Learned APP for the State opposes the prayer for

bail of the petitioner and submits that criminal antecedent of the

petitioner is not clean as there are 13 cases pending against him

which indicates that the petitioner used to involve in such type

of activities and this aspect must be taken into consideration.
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.42381 of 2025(2) dt.09-07-2025
3/3

6. In the present facts and circumstances, this Court is

not inclined to grant bail to the petitioner. Accordingly, the

prayer for anticipatory bail of the petitioner is hereby rejected

with liberty that if, petitioner surrenders before the Trial Court

within a period of 4 weeks from today then in that case, the Trial

Court is directed to pass order on his surrender-cum-bail

application on the same day, without being prejudice that the

anticipatory bail of the petitioner has been rejected by this Court

and the Trial Court shall pass order on the merit of this case.
